نبذة مختصرة : to describe some perceptions about the ageing of a group of old people as presented by a research regarding their life paths in Caldas, Antioquia Colombia. Methodology: it is an ethnographic study in which observation, semi-structured and group interviews and documentary review were employed with the aim to understand the processes of social reproduction. Social universe: men and women over 60 living in the Caldas urban area, Antioquia, willing to participate and without cognitive alterations. Results: this work allowed us to discover that senior citizens acknowledge that death, pension, illness and solitude define old age and that their present situation is related with the inclusive or exclusive conditions of past and present times. Conclusions: the old people taking part in the research consider old age by negative stereotypes probably because the majority of them live in a state of vulnerability not only because of age since they suffer as well historical debts related to dismissal from employment, lack of social security, low schooling (specially in the case of women), limited economic and social state support.
